From: Heiner Kallweit <hkallwe...@gmail.com> Date: Sun, 9 Dec 2018 22:05:11 +0100
> If CONFIG_DEBUG_SHIRQ is enabled __free_irq() intentionally fires > a spurious interrupt. This interrupt causes a crash because > tp->dev->phydev is NULL at that time. > > Fixes: 38caff5a445b ("r8169: handle all interrupt events in the hard irq > handler") > Signed-off-by: Heiner Kallweit <hkallwe...@gmail.com> I'll apply this, thanks Heiner.